Condition Assessment of Bundling Machines in Used Welding Pipe Mills

【概要描述】Condition Assessment of Bundling Machines in Used Welding Pipe Mills

Evaluating the condition of a bundling machine in a used welding pipe mill requires a systematic approach to determine its operational reliability and remaining service life. Below are key aspects to consider during inspection.

Structural Integrity and Frame Condition
Inspect the main frame for cracks, rust, or deformations that may affect stability. Check mounting points and welded joints for signs of stress or repair work. A stable frame is essential for consistent performance in a used welding pipe mill environment.

Mechanical Component Wear
Examine high-wear parts such as strapping heads, tensioners, and compression arms. Look for excessive play in bearings, worn gears, or misaligned guides. Assess the condition of hydraulic/pneumatic cylinders and seals for leaks or reduced efficiency.

Electrical and Control System Functionality
Test all electrical components, including motors, sensors, and control panels. Verify the responsiveness of the PLC system and check for outdated or damaged wiring. Ensure safety interlocks and emergency stops function correctly, as these are critical in a used welding pipe mill setup.

Strapping Mechanism Performance
Evaluate the strapping system for consistent tension and sealing quality. Inspect feed rollers, seals, and cutting blades for wear. Test with different strap materials to confirm adaptability. Poor strapping performance can disrupt the entire used welding pipe mill production line.

Production Trial and Output Quality
Conduct a test run with actual pipes to assess real-world performance. Monitor bundle consistency, strapping accuracy, and cycle times. Check for misalignments or jams that may indicate underlying issues. Compare results with the machine’s original specifications.

Maintenance History and Documentation
Review service records to understand past repairs, part replacements, and usage patterns. A well-documented history increases confidence in the machine’s condition. Lack of records may require more conservative assumptions about remaining lifespan.

Compatibility with the Used Welding Pipe Mill
Ensure the bundler integrates smoothly with existing equipment. Check communication protocols, material handling synchronization, and safety system compatibility. A mismatched bundler can create bottlenecks in production.

By thoroughly assessing these factors, buyers can make informed decisions about the value and suitability of a bundling machine for their used welding pipe mill. Professional inspections are recommended for high-value equipment to avoid costly surprises post-purchase.
